Dental implants have revolutionized the way missing teeth are replaced, offering a sturdy and aesthetically pleasing answer for lots of individuals. However, like several surgical procedure, they come with potential risks, some of the alarming being infection. Understanding tips on how to deal with dental implant see this here infection is essential for both prevention and remedy if it happens.
Awareness of the signs and symptoms of a dental implant infection can be the first line of defense. Common indicators include persistent pain at the implant web site, swelling, redness, and elevated sensitivity. Fever or an disagreeable style within the mouth can also sign an underlying issue. Recognizing these signs early is essential for effective remedy.
Maintaining glorious oral hygiene is important to stopping infections associated with dental implants. Regular brushing and flossing help in reducing micro organism buildup across the implant website. It’s advisable to make use of a non-abrasive toothpaste and a soft-bristle toothbrush to avoid irritation around the gums. Regular dental check-ups will additional improve hygiene and catch potential points early.
In some cases, infection can happen after the implant surgery. This could presumably be as a outcome of various elements, similar to pre-existing medical conditions, smoking, or poor oral hygiene. Those with compromised immune methods or persistent diseases could additionally be extra susceptible to infections (Dental Implant And Bridges Norton Shores MI). Likewise, individuals who smoke may face the next risk as a end result of reduced blood circulate to the gums and delay in therapeutic

If an infection does occur, quick action is critical. Consulting with a dentist or oral surgeon as quickly as signs appear is essential. Ignoring the signs can probably result in critical complications, corresponding to bone loss across the implant, which may jeopardize the entire process. Professionals can assess the implant, perform necessary exams, and develop an appropriate treatment plan.
Treatment usually entails antibiotics to fight the infection. Dentists could prescribe a course of oral antibiotics to remove the micro organism inflicting the difficulty. Depending on the severity, different interventions could be essential, such as draining any accumulated pus or infected materials. Follow-up appointments might be integral to monitor the therapeutic course of.

Home care after receiving antibiotics is equally important. Rinsing with heat salt water might help soothe the inflamed gums and promote therapeutic. Using an antibacterial mouthwash may assist in reducing micro organism ranges in the mouth. These supportive measures can considerably help the recovery process.
Some sufferers may require further surgical intervention if the infection is extreme or doesn't respond to antibiotic therapy. This might involve eradicating the implant, cleaning the infected space, and probably placing a model new implant after acceptable healing. It’s important to discuss all available choices with a professional dental skilled.
Understanding the chance factors associated with dental implant infection can even promote better decision-making. Those with diabetes, autoimmune conditions, or different systemic points ought to have a radical discussion with their dentist earlier than proceeding with implants (Dental Teeth Implants Walker MI). Lifestyle factors like smoking and poor nutritional habits can enhance infection risks, making it essential to handle these behaviors
Preventing infections is not solely about sustaining personal hygiene. Diet plays a major role as properly. A well-balanced food plan rich in vitamins and minerals can enhance the immune system and promote therapeutic. Foods high in vitamin C and calcium could be significantly beneficial for oral health. Hydration can be key, aiding within the production of saliva, which naturally helps combat micro organism.

Keeping the implant website clean and free from debris is crucial instantly post-surgery. It is advisable to comply with the dentist's postoperative care instructions meticulously. If advised, utilizing a water flosser may help be positive that hard-to-reach areas are adequately cleaned without making use of extreme strain.
Continuous training about dental care and the potential of infections can empower individuals. Engaging with dental professionals to be taught extra about the newest recommendations and practices can result in higher outcomes. Many assets, together with pamphlets and on-line materials, present useful data on sustaining dental implants.
For those who expertise long-term complications or recurring infections, session with a specialist might be warranted. An oral surgeon can assess the scenario intently, reviewing each the implant and the encompassing tissues. in some instances, bone grafting procedures may be needed to bolster the world earlier than one other implant can be placed.

Common signs of a dental implant infection embrace pain at the implant web site, swelling, redness, or drainage of pus. If you notice any of those signs, consult your dentist instantly for assessment and remedy.
How is a dental implant infection diagnosed?
A dental skilled will perform a medical examination, take X-rays, and consider your medical history. Dental Implants Whole Mouth Holland MI. They could check for any signs of irritation or bone loss across the implant to substantiate the diagnosis

What should I do if I suspect an infection?
If you suspect an infection, contact your dentist as soon as attainable. They may prescribe antibiotics and advocate pain management methods. Avoid self-treatment to prevent further issues.
Can dental implant infections be treated at home?
While proper oral hygiene might help manage minor points, dental implant infections require professional therapy. Avoid residence remedies and seek your dentist's recommendation to handle the infection effectively.

What are the potential complications of an untreated dental implant infection?
Untreated infections can lead to bone loss, implant failure, and the unfold of infection to surrounding tissues. This may end up in more serious health issues, so immediate remedy is crucial.
How long does it take to recover from a dental implant infection?

Recovery time varies relying on the severity of the infection and the treatment acquired. Generally, with applicable medical care, signs could improve within a quantity of days, however full recovery could take several weeks.
Can I still receive dental implants if I've had an infection before?
Having a historical past of infection would not routinely disqualify you from receiving implants. Your dentist will evaluate your oral health and any underlying conditions before making a suggestion.
Is it normal to have some discomfort after implant placement?

Mild discomfort is frequent after implant placement and often resolves inside a couple of days. However, persistent or worsening pain may point out an infection, requiring quick dental evaluation.
What preventive measures can I take to keep away from dental implant infections?

Maintaining excellent oral hygiene, attending regular dental check-ups, and following post-operative care instructions are crucial. Avoid smoking and inform your dentist of any health modifications that might affect your recovery.
